How did we get from our dystopian present to a hopeful 2065?
About this Event

Join SEED_2065: MAPPING THE RUPTURE!

About this event:
In 2025, the Seed_2065 project began with 21 artists imagining a future rooted in peaceful relationships with the other-than-human. Now, we invite you to help us map "The Rupture"—the 40-year journey of transformation and repair.
The Workshop:
This is a high-energy, collaborative "blueprint" session. You will work alongside artists from the original Seed_2065 cohort in small, focused design groups. Together, we will use the floor space to create a single, interconnected "History of the Future."
From "Interspecies Treaties" to "Rewilding Blueprints," your ideas will be archived and used as direct inspiration for the next phase of the Seed_2065 exhibition in 2026.
What to expect:
• Collaborative Design: Join a small group anchored by a Seed_2065 artist to tackle specific "Silos of Change."
• Large-Scale Mapping: We will work on a massive paper canvas to plan the architecture of a new world.
• Conceptual Making: A focused session using diagrams, drawing, story-telling, and radical imagination.
• Community & Coffee: Tea and coffee facilities are available in the kitchen. Please arrive 10 minutes early to settle in.


This event is not limited to those with an art background or training. All are welcome.
